If you’re thinking about buying property in North Florida, one of the biggest questions is:

👉 “How much land do I actually need?”

Should you go with 1 acre, 5 acres, or 10+ acres?

In areas like Keystone Heights, Melrose, Hawthorne, Interlachen, and Lake Butler, the answer depends on your lifestyle, budget, and long-term plans.

Let’s break it down so you can make the right decision.


🏡 1 Acre – Simple, Affordable, and Low Maintenance

For many buyers, 1 acre is the perfect starting point.

✔ What You Get:

• Space between neighbors
• Room for a small garden or outdoor setup
• Lower maintenance compared to larger parcels
• More affordable entry point

👉 Best For:

• First-time buyers
• Downsizers
• Buyers wanting some privacy without too much upkeep

💡 Reality Check:
You’ll have more space than a typical neighborhood—but not full seclusion.


🌿 5 Acres – The Sweet Spot

For many North Florida buyers, 5 acres is the ideal balance.

✔ What You Get:

• Significant privacy
• Room for animals (check zoning 🐎🐄)
• Space for a workshop, garden, or future additions
• Flexibility without overwhelming maintenance

👉 Best For:

• Families wanting room to grow
• Buyers interested in a mini homestead
• Those wanting privacy + usability

💡 Why It’s Popular:
You get freedom without the full responsibility of large acreage.


🌾 10+ Acres – Full Freedom & Long-Term Investment

If you’re dreaming big, 10+ acres opens the door to serious possibilities.

✔ What You Get:

• Total privacy 🌳
• Room for farming, livestock, or multiple structures
• Long-term investment potential
• Space to create a true homestead lifestyle

👉 Best For:

• Farmers & hobby farmers
• Investors
• Buyers wanting maximum space & control

💡 Reality Check:
More land = more maintenance, more cost, and more planning.


💰 Cost Differences You Should Know

As acreage increases, so do the costs—but not always in the way you expect.

Consider:

✔ Land purchase price
✔ Land clearing costs
✔ Septic & well installation
✔ Fencing & maintenance

👉 Example:
• 1 acre = lower upfront + lower upkeep
• 10 acres = more flexibility, but higher setup costs

⚠️ Common Mistakes Buyers Make

🚫 Buying too much land and feeling overwhelmed
🚫 Not checking zoning for animals or mobile homes
🚫 Underestimating maintenance costs
🚫 Not planning for utilities (well, septic, power)

👉 These can turn a great property into a frustrating experience
